+namespace policy { |
+ |
+// Helper for implementing policies referencing external data: This class |
+// observes a given |policy_| and fetches the external data that it references |
+// for all users on the device. Notifications are emitted when an external data |
+// reference is set, cleared or an external data fetch completes successfully. |
+// |
+// State is kept at runtime only: External data references that already exist |
+// when the class is instantiated are considered new, causing a notification to |
+// be emitted that an external data reference has been set and the referenced |
+// external data to be fetched. |
+class CloudExternalDataPolicyObserverChromeOS |
+ : public content::NotificationObserver, |
+ public DeviceLocalAccountPolicyService::Observer { |
+ public: |
+ CloudExternalDataPolicyObserverChromeOS( |
+ chromeos::CrosSettings* cros_settings, |
+ chromeos::UserManager* user_manager, |
+ DeviceLocalAccountPolicyService* device_local_account_policy_service, |
+ const std::string& policy); |
+ virtual ~CloudExternalDataPolicyObserverChromeOS(); |
+ |
+ void Init(); |
+ |
+ virtual void Shutdown(); |

+ // Invoked when an external data reference is set for |user_id|. |
+ virtual void OnExternalDataSet(const std::string& user_id) = 0; |
+ |
+ // Invoked when the external data reference is cleared for |user_id|. |
+ virtual void OnExternalDataCleared(const std::string& user_id) = 0; |
+ |
+ // Invoked when the external data referenced for |user_id| has been fetched. |
+ // Failed fetches are retried and the method is called only when a fetch |
+ // eventually succeeds. If a fetch fails permanently (e.g. because the |
+ // external data reference specifies an invalid URL), the method is not called |
+ // at all. |
+ virtual void OnExternalDataFetched(const std::string& user_id, |
+ scoped_ptr<std::string> data) = 0; |
